MSSQL Server驱动企业数据管理升级

1. MSSQL Server驱动企业数据管理升级

MSSQL Server,全称Microsoft SQL Server,是由微软开发的一款关系数据库管理系统(RDBMS),可以在Windows平台上运行,广泛用于企业级数据管理。

随着大数据时代的到来,企业对于数据的需求越来越高,同时对数据安全性、稳定性以及处理效率的要求也日益提高。为了满足这些需求,MSSQL Server有必要对其进行升级和更新。

1.1 MSSQL Server的升级需求

在目前的市场环境下,企业对于数据的要求越来越高,包括数据安全性、数据处理效率以及数据的随时可用性等。因此,对于数据库管理系统来说,也面临着更多的挑战,需要更加稳定、高效、可靠的运行方式。

同时,面对新的技术和应用,MSSQL Server也需要适时升级来满足企业的新需求。

1.2 MSSQL Server的升级方案

为了满足企业在数据处理效率、安全性等方面的需求,MSSQL Server需要逐步升级来适应新的市场需求。具体的升级方案如下:

1.2.1 采用自主研发的高效驱动

为了提高数据处理效率,MSSQL Server可以采用自主研发的高效驱动来提供更加稳定、高效、可靠的数据库管理服务。这可以极大地提高服务器的处理效率,降低CPU和内存等资源的使用率,从而提高整个系统的性能。

以下是MSSQL Server自主开发的高效驱动的示例:

SELECT * FROM Sales

WHERE YEAR(OrderDate) = 2020 AND ProductID = 1001

上述示例代码可以极大地提高查询速度,减少时间的浪费,提高数据处理效率。

1.2.2 改善系统安全性

为了提高数据安全性,MSSQL Server需要改善系统的安全性功能,包括数据加密、身份验证、访问控制等。只有确保数据安全,才能更加信任数据库系统。

以下是对数据库进行数据加密的示例代码:

CREATE SYMMETRIC KEY KeyData

WITH ALGORITHM = AES_256

ENCRYPTION BY PASSWORD = 'password';

OPEN SYMMETRIC KEY KeyData

DECRYPTION BY PASSWORD = 'password';

DECLARE @encrypt varbinary(100);

SET @encrypt = ENCRYPTBYKEY(Key_GUID('KeyData'), '明文数据');

SELECT CAST(DECRYPTBYKEY(@encrypt) AS NVARCHAR(100)) AS Data_Decrypt;

CLOSE SYMMETRIC KEY KeyData;

DROP SYMMETRIC KEY KeyData;

上述示例代码可以对MSSQL Server中的敏感数据进行加密,保障数据安全性。

1.2.3 提高数据的可靠性

为了提高数据的可靠性,MSSQL Server需要采用备份、恢复、故障转移等多种技术手段,确保数据随时可用。这也是现代企业对于数据管理系统的要求之一。

以下是MSSQL Server进行数据备份的示例代码:

BACKUP DATABASE MyDatabase

TO DISK = 'D:\MyDatabase.bak'

WITH NOFORMAT, NOINIT, NAME = 'MyDatabase-Backup',

SKIP, NOREWIND, NOUNLOAD,

STATS = 5;

上述示例代码可以对MSSQL Server中的数据进行备份,确保数据的可靠性。

2. 总结

MSSQL Server作为一款企业级数据库管理系统,需要不断升级和更新来满足不断变化的市场需求。通过采用自主研发的高效驱动、改善系统的安全性、提高数据的可靠性等多种技术手段,可以更好地满足企业对于数据管理系统的要求,帮助企业更好地处理数据,提高核心竞争力。

数据库标签